Method
Instructions
- 1
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ease an 8-inch square baking pan or a cast-iron skillet.
- 2
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together the cornmeal, fl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t until well combined.
- 3
Combine Wet Ingredients
In a separate bowl, whisk together 1 cup of milk, 2 large eggs, and 1/4 cup of melted butter until smooth.
- 4
Combine Mixtures
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ined. Do not overmix; a few lumps are okay.
- 5
Bake
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an or skillet.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- 6
Cool and Serve
Let the cornbread cool for a few minutes before cutting into squares. Serve warm, perfect for soaking up sauces.
